    South Dakota Pheasant Hunting Is Changing, Or Has Changed

    Hunter numbers have fallen here in MN across the board too. I looked up the historical data for resident license sales about a week ago, just out of curiosity. Small game (which is primarily pheasant, grouse, and waterfowl) is down a whopping 75% from its peak in 1977. Deer firearms license...

    How many birds do you shoot in a season?

    I don't shoot that many and I definitely have trouble staying under the possession limit. I give a lot away. The possession limit here in MN is only 6 until Dec 1, then it goes to 9, which helps some.
